For how long does it take to get a French driving license?
The duration mostly depends on private development, but typically, the procedure can take anywhere from 3 to six months, considering driving lessons and the assessment schedule.
2. Just how much does it cost to obtain a French driving license?
The overall cost typically differs based on the driving school, however candidates ought to spending plan around EUR1,500 to EUR2,000, that includes enrollment charges, lessons, and assessment expenses.
3. Can I drive with a foreign license in France?
Yes, however you can usually only utilize your foreign license for a restricted duration (approximately one year). After that, you might require to obtain a French driving license, specifically if you are a homeowner.
4. Are there exceptions for EU citizens relating to license exchange?
Yes, EU citizens can usually exchange their driving license for a French one without retaking tests, provided their original license is valid.
